Romanian Market Context

The state of tech adoption in Romania, particularly in manufacturing, is evolving but at a slower pace compared to Western Europe. According to recent studies, only 20% of Romanian factories have implemented any form of IoT technology. This lag can be attributed to several factors, including budget constraints and risk aversion.

Common mistakes Romanian businesses make include investing in outdated technology and failing to integrate new systems with existing processes. However, the Romanian market presents unique opportunities for growth. The local legislative environment, including GDPR compliance, provides a structured framework that businesses can leverage to ensure data security and privacy.

Technical Deep Dive

Technology Stack Considerations

Implementing IoT in production involves selecting the right technology stack. Key components include IoT sensors, data processing units, and cloud platforms for data storage and analysis. Choosing scalable and flexible technologies ensures long-term sustainability.

Architecture Decisions

A robust IoT architecture should facilitate seamless data flow from sensors to analytics platforms. Considerations include network bandwidth, latency, and fault tolerance to ensure uninterrupted operations.

Security & Compliance

With the introduction of GDPR, Romanian businesses must prioritize data protection. Implementing strong encryption and access controls are essential to safeguard sensitive information.

Scalability Planning

As factories expand, their IoT systems must scale accordingly. Planning for scalability involves choosing cloud solutions that offer flexible storage and processing power.

Integration with Existing Systems

Successful IoT implementations require integration with existing ERP and accounting systems. This ensures a unified view of production data and financial metrics, enhancing decision-making capabilities.

Cost & Timeline Expectations

Typical IoT projects in Romania can range from €50,000 to €200,000, depending on complexity and scope. Projects usually take 6-12 months from inception to deployment. Payment models can vary, with options for fixed-price or time and materials contracts.

Success Stories

A notable example is a Romanian textile manufacturer that implemented an IoT system to monitor energy consumption, leading to a 25% reduction in costs. Another success is a local food processing company that optimized its supply chain through real-time data analytics, increasing efficiency by 30%.
